Question help only can make right hand turns?????

I have a 73 f-100 4x4 with manual steering. I just replace the steering box and now can only turn the steering wheel to the right. Please help with some advice on getting every thing centered. I am new with this whole truck stuff I dont know alot about the steering parts just the engine and trans. Any help would be excellent.

Did you install the pitman arm yourself? You may have installed it 45 deg the wrong direction, and the box is out of travel. You may have to straighten the wheels, and the remove the pitman arm, then turn the box (steering wheel, because now it is attatched) until it is centered within its travel, and re-install the arm. I think this may be your trouble.

I think the manual box is multi indexed to install the arm in different orientations. The power assist with the hydro assist does not. I don't wanna send you on a wild goose chase, but I think we are headed in the right direction here, good luck.
